كيفية جعل ملف دفعي إعادة تسمية ملف إلى التاريخ أو الوقت

هناك بعض الطرق المختلفة لكيفية القيام بذلك. فيما يلي مثال على كيفية استخدام الأمر date في الأمر for لاستخراج التاريخ الحالي واستخدام تلك البيانات لإعادة تسمية الملف. سيتم وضع كل أمر من الأوامر المدرجة في هذا المستند في ملف دفعي.

تاريخ

لـ / f "الرموز المميزة = 1-5 delims = /" ٪٪ d in ("٪ date٪") قم بإعادة تسمية "hope.txt" ٪٪ e - ٪٪ f - ٪٪ g.txt

أدناه هو انهيار الأمر أعلاه وما يعنيه كل شيء.

  • for / f - الأمر for و / f التبديل.
  • "الرموز المميزة = 1-5 delims = /" - كم عدد الرموز المميزة التي سيتم تقسيم البيانات الواردة إليها (في هذه الحالة ، التاريخ) ؛ 1-5 خمسة رموز مختلفة. أخيرًا ، delims قصيرة بالنسبة إلى المحددات وهو ما يُستخدم لتفريق التاريخ ، في هذا المثال / (شرطة مائلة للأمام) ومسافة (مسافة قبل علامة الاقتباس).
  • ٪٪ d - حرف البداية المستخدم في الرمز المميز. نظرًا لوجود 5 رموز في هذا المثال ، فسيكون d و e و f و g و h.
  • في ("٪ date٪") - البيانات المستخدمة ، وفي هذه الحالة ، يكون٪ date٪ هو التاريخ الحالي للكمبيوتر.
  • تفعل - ما يفعله الأمر. يمكن استبدال أمر إعادة التسمية بأي شيء آخر.
  • إعادة تسمية "hope.txt" ٪٪ e - ٪٪ f - ٪٪ g.txt - إعادة تسمية الملف "hope.txt" إلى الرموز المميزة e و f و g مع ملحق ملف .txt. يحتوي هذا المثال أيضًا على - (واصلة) بين كل رمز مميز لفصل الشهر واليوم والسنة في اسم الملف.

عند استخدام٪ date٪ في ملف دفعي ، يعرض التاريخ بالتنسيق التالي: Sun 09/02/2007 يقسم هذا الأمر هذا التاريخ إلى الرموز المميزة: "Sun" (٪٪ d) ، "09" (٪٪ e ) و "02" (٪٪ f) و "2007" (٪٪ g).

في هذا المثال ، باستخدام التاريخ المذكور أعلاه ، سيتم إعادة تسمية hope.txt إلى 09-02-2007.txt.

زمن

لـ / f "الرموز المميزة = 1-5 delims =:" ٪٪ d in ("٪ time٪") تقوم بإعادة تسمية "hope.txt" ٪٪ d - ٪٪ e.txt

يشبه هذا الأمر المثال السابق. ومع ذلك ، بدلاً من استخدام شرطة مائلة للأمام ومساحة لتفكيك البيانات التي نستخدمها: (نقطتان) لأن الوقت يتم تقسيمه باستخدام هذه الشخصية. أخيرًا ، نظرًا لأننا نعيد تسمية الملف إلى الساعة والدقيقة فقط ، فإن هذا المثال يستخدم فقط الرمز المميز d و e. تم العثور على معلومات إضافية حول ما يعنيه كل شيء في هذا السطر في مثال التاريخ أعلاه.

عند استخدام٪ time٪ في ملف دفعي ، يعرض الوقت بالتنسيق التالي: 19: 34: 52.25 ، يقسم هذا الأمر هذه المرة إلى الرموز: "19" (٪٪ d) ، "34" (٪٪ e ) و "52.25" (٪٪ f).

في هذا المثال ، باستخدام الوقت المذكور أعلاه ، ستتم إعادة تسمية Hope.txt إلى 19-34.txt.